Your Role:

The Network Engineer 2 at Milliporesigma will report to the Head of Networks for North/South America and is an important part of the foundational layer of the infrastructure organization for the company.

  • Communicate and collaborate effectively with other members of the network team, the IT organization and the business community
  • Act as an integral part of the global the network team providing support and services primarily during North American business hours.
  • Handle support and escalation activities brought to the network group via support tickets, automated monitoring, user reporting, etc.
  • Work outside of normal business hours may be required as necessitated by business need
  • Enforce network and network security standards throughout the infrastructure
  • Provide a positive and professional user experience at all times when engaging both internal and external users.
  • Be part of a performance driven, risk taking culture that promotes open and honest feedback.
  • Think globally and work across departments and geographies, encouraging teamwork that respects diverse backgrounds and cultural differences to drive results.
  • Ability to travel domestically 10% and internationally up to 10%

Who You Are:

Minimum Qualifications:
  • High School Diploma or GED
  • 3+ years of hands-on experience in full-cycle design, engineering, configuration and administration of routers & switches, firewalls, multi-segment networks and MPLS WANs
  • 3+ years of enterprise wired and wireless network technologies experience
  • 3+ years of experience with various networking protocols and technologies such as HTTP - HTTPS - DNS - VPN (IPSec/SSL) - TCP/IP stack - FTP - TFTP - SMTP - IEEE Standards - QoS - VoIP (H.323, SIP) OSPF, MPLS, ACL's, eBGP /iBGP, 802.1D/W, Policy Based and Static routing, Fiber Channel over Ethernet, VRF and Virtual Device Contexts
